User Experience and Use Cases

How does the cream work in real life? Here’s what to expect:

  • Use Cases: Dog diaper rash cream is used for dogs wearing diapers. It helps with redness, itching, and sores. It’s also good for dogs with skin irritation around their rear.
  • Application: Clean the area gently before applying the cream. Apply a thin layer. Do this every time you change the diaper.
  • Results: You should see improvement within a few days. The redness and itching should go down.
  • Consistency: Use the cream as directed. This is important for healing.
  • When to See a Vet: If the rash gets worse or doesn’t improve, see your vet. They can rule out other problems.

Dog Diaper Rash Cream: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What causes diaper rash in dogs?

A: Diaper rash happens from wet diapers, urine, and poop. It can also happen from friction from the diaper.

Q: How do I apply the cream?

A: Clean the area first. Then, apply a thin layer of cream. Do this after every diaper change.

Q: How often should I change my dog’s diaper?

A: Change the diaper often. This helps prevent diaper rash. Change it as soon as it gets wet or dirty.

Q: What if the cream doesn’t work?

A: If the rash doesn’t improve, talk to your vet. They might have other solutions.

Q: Can I use human diaper rash cream on my dog?

A: Some creams are okay, but some have ingredients that are not safe for dogs. It is better to use a dog-specific cream.

Q: How do I clean my dog’s bottom?

A: Use a soft cloth and warm water. Avoid harsh soaps or wipes that might irritate the skin.

Q: What ingredients should I avoid?

A: Avoid creams with strong fragrances, parabens, and sulfates. These can be irritating.

Q: How long does it take to see results?

A: You should see improvement within a few days. The rash should start to heal quickly.

Q: Can I prevent diaper rash?

A: Yes! Changing diapers often and keeping the area clean helps prevent diaper rash.
